About

  • Mr. Alphin is the managing partner of Lloyd & McDaniel, PLC, whose practice concentrates primarily in commercial and retail litigation
  • After spending two years as an attorney with the Jefferson County Public Defender’s Office, Mr. Alphin joined Lloyd & McDaniel PLC in 2003
  • He now not only represents a broad range of clients but also works to market and manage the retail collections operation within Lloyd & McDaniel PLC
  • Mr. Alphin is also very active with the National Creditors Bar Association (NCBA), where he has held multiple leadership roles
  • He is a past three term member of the NCBA Board of Directors
  • Concentration(s) Retail and Commercial Debt Collection, Former Criminal Defense Litigator Professional Affiliations Kentucky Bar Association, Louisville Bar Association, Kentucky Creditors Rights Bar Association, Member of the Board of Directors of the National Association of Retail Collection Attorneys

Jurisdictional Context

Why local counsel matters in Kentucky

Practicing law in Kentucky. Legal matters in Kentucky are governed by state-specific rules of civil and criminal procedure, statutes of limitations, and substantive law. Cases originating in Louisville are typically filed in the local municipal court or the appropriate Kentucky state district court, depending on subject matter and amount in controversy. An attorney licensed in Kentucky brings working knowledge of local procedural deadlines, judicial practices in this andnue, and the substantive law that applies to cases brought here. Out-of-state attorneys generally cannot represent clients in Kentucky courts without local counsel or pro hac vice admission.
